Vinyl siding repair services involve fixing damaged or deteriorated sections of vinyl siding on residential or commercial properties. Over time, siding can become cracked, warped, or loose due to weather exposure, impacts, or age. Repair work typically includes replacing broken panels, reattaching loose siding, and sealing gaps to restore the appearance and functionality of the exterior.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to ensure repairs blend seamlessly with existing siding, helping to maintain the property's curb appeal and protect it from the elements.

Many problems can be addressed through vinyl siding repair, including cracks, holes, warping, or sections that have come loose. These issues not only impact the visual appeal of a property but can also lead to more serious concerns like water infiltration, mold growth, or structural damage if left unaddressed. Repair services can also help prevent further deterioration by reinforcing weakened areas and ensuring that siding remains securely attached. This makes vinyl siding repair a practical solution for homeowners noticing damage or signs of aging on their exterior cladding.

The overview below groups typical Vinyl Siding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or vinyl siding repairs typically cost between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. Most projects in this range involve patching small sections or replacing individual panels. Larger or more complex repairs can exceed this range but are less common.

Moderate Repairs - Mid-sized siding repair projects usually fall between $600 and $1,500. These often include replacing multiple panels or addressing more extensive damage, which local contractors handle regularly within this budget.

Full Siding Replacement - Replacing entire sections or an entire house’s siding can range from $3,000 to $8,000, depending on the size and material quality. Many full replacements are at the lower to mid end of this range, with larger, more elaborate projects reaching higher costs.

Complete Home Siding Overhaul - A full siding overhaul, including removal and replacement of all exterior siding, can cost $10,000 or more for larger homes. These comprehensive projects are less common and typically fall into the highest price tiers handled by experienced local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can vinyl siding repair address? Vinyl siding repair can fix issues such as cracks, holes, warping, and loose panels to restore the appearance and integrity of the siding.

How do local contractors handle vinyl siding repairs? Local service providers assess the damage, remove or replace affected panels, and ensure the repair blends seamlessly with existing siding.

Is vinyl siding repair suitable for all types of damage? Vinyl siding repair is effective for common issues like cracks and holes, but extensive damage or structural problems may require more comprehensive solutions.

Can vinyl siding be repaired without replacing entire sections? Yes, many repairs involve replacing only the damaged panels or sections, making the process more cost-effective and less invasive.

What should I consider when choosing a local contractor for vinyl siding repair? Consider their experience with vinyl siding, reputation in the community, and ability to match existing siding styles and colors.
